Tractor & Trailer Mechanics perform preventative & corrective diagnostics and repairs in routine and emergency situations. Mechanics must be organized, dependable, and proficient to maintain assigned equipment. Mechanics should be physically and mentally fit and have a solid knowledge of technical tools. Mechanics possess some customer service skills as well as the ability to diagnose and resolve mechanical & technical problems quickly and effectively. Mechanics assist fleet maintenance team with new technology, equipment updates, and ongoing support. Mechanics assist to identify, develop and implement process improvements. Duties and Responsibilities
Preventive Maintenance

  • Conduct mileage & time-based preventative maintenance as scheduled
  • Complete visual inspections to capture defects and hazards before they become an issue
  • Complete all fleet issued maintenance bulletins & reminders

Corrective Maintenance

  • Repair equipment upon failures to ensure safe and reliable operation
  • Create a plan of action for all repairs required
  • Maintain Driver Vehicle Inspection Reports and perform corrective actions as needed
  • Troubleshoot equipment with diagnostic programs
  • Maintain diagnostic tooling, shop tools, and shop equipment
  • Be available for on-call troubleshooting

Parts

  • Manage (order, account for, & issue) parts inventory to decrease down time
  • Ship and receive materials in an organized & timely manner
  • Keep parts storeroom clean, uncluttered, & organized

Safety

  • Able to follow all safe work practices and company safety guidelines
  • Able to lift, bend, and stand to meet physical requirements of position

Recording

  • Complete all work orders with documentation in distribution business platform
  • Follow checklists and protocol while conducting repairs

Teamwork

  • Collaborate with site management and local vendors to schedule equipment repairs
